Evoland

The game has a cool idea, but...

The game has its moments, the puzzle parts in particular are really cool... but it has a pretty high encounter rate and a rather generic soundtrack... the 2D graphics are incredible, but the 3D ones are a bit generic... the game has its positive and negative points, and it's worth giving it a chance.

River City Girls

Amazing game, but it has its problems...

The game has incredible graphics, good retro gameplay, and a chilling soundtrack. But, it has its problems, some bugs and lack of polish. The main bug for me was the recruit character, where in the school part, whenever I called him the game bugged and kept crashing. The only way I found to resolve this was to avoid calling the recruit as much as possible until I left school.

Evan's Remains

It's worth giving a chance

The game is excellent in some aspects such as graphics and soundtrack, which are excellent. The puzzles are cool, even quite easy (it took me an average of 1 to 2 minutes on each puzzle), but I believe they're on point, the puzzle mechanics are interesting too, I've never seen anything like it. I find the plot very complex and somewhat confusing, but in the end, just pay a little attention and most people can understand it. Conclusion: it's worth giving it a chance, mainly because it's cheap and short.
